
java购物车如何添加到数据库
用户关注问题
如何将购物车中的商品信息保存到数据库中?
我有一个Java购物车应用,想把用户选择的商品和数量保存到数据库中,应该如何操作?
保存购物车商品到数据库的方法
可以通过将购物车中的商品对象转换为数据库中的记录来实现。首先需要设计好数据库表结构,通常包含商品ID、商品名称、数量、价格和用户ID等字段。然后在Java代码中,使用JDBC或ORM框架(如Hibernate)执行插入操作,将购物车信息写入到对应的表里。确保操作在事务内执行,以保证数据一致性。
购物车数据添加到数据库时需要注意哪些问题?
在Java项目中把购物车信息存入数据库过程中,可能会遇到哪些问题,需要留意什么?
保存购物车数据时的常见注意事项
应确保商品库存的实时性,避免超卖情况;对购物车的每次修改都应该同步更新数据库;处理好数据的并发访问,避免出现脏数据;设计好事务控制,保证插入或更新操作的原子性;还需要防范SQL注入等安全风险。
Java中用什么技术实现购物车数据的数据库操作最合适?
在Java开发购物车功能时,推荐使用哪些技术或框架将购物车数据保存到数据库中?
推荐的Java数据库操作技术和框架
JDBC是最基础的数据库访问技术,适合简单项目,但需要手动管理SQL和连接。Hibernate和MyBatis是常见的ORM框架,能高效地映射Java对象和数据库表,简化数据库操作代码。此外,Spring Data JPA也很受欢迎,整合了JPA标准,使数据操作更便捷。选择时可以根据项目复杂度和团队技能水平决定。